Web1 dec. 2024 · Fun Fact. “ Maverick “- originally was in reference to unbranded cattle. The word Maverick means an independently minded person. Samuel A. Maverick (1803-1870) was a Texas land baron and cattle owner who refused to brand his cattle. In the mid 1800’s, a calf or yearling without a brand became known as a Maverick.
